The Data Center Gold Rush: Understanding the Boom

The explosion of cloud computing, the Internet of Things (IoT), artificial intelligence (AI), and 5G technology is fueling an exponential increase in data storage and processing needs. This translates directly into a massive demand for data centers – the physical infrastructure that powers the digital world. Consequently, companies involved in building, owning, and operating these facilities are experiencing phenomenal growth.

This growth is not just limited to a few mega-corporations. Numerous smaller players are capitalizing on the opportunity, leading to a diverse and dynamic market. Key factors contributing to this boom include:

  • Hyperscale Cloud Growth: Giants like Amazon Web Services (AWS), Microsoft Azure, and Google Cloud Platform (GCP) are continuously expanding their data center footprints to meet the insatiable demand for cloud services. This fuels significant demand for construction and infrastructure support.
  • Edge Computing Expansion: The rise of edge computing, which brings data processing closer to the source, requires a denser network of smaller data centers. This decentralized approach creates new opportunities for smaller companies and regional players.
  • 5G Infrastructure Deployment: The rollout of 5G networks is generating massive amounts of data, requiring significant upgrades and expansion of existing data center capacity.
  • AI and Machine Learning: The rapid development of AI and machine learning applications necessitates powerful computing infrastructure, further driving demand for high-performance data centers.

The China Question: Navigating Geopolitical Risks

While the data center sector presents significant opportunities, investors must be aware of the inherent geopolitical risks. China's growing role in the global technology landscape introduces complexities, particularly regarding data security and regulatory uncertainty.

  • Increased Regulation: The Chinese government has intensified its scrutiny of data centers, imposing stricter regulations on data localization and cybersecurity. This can affect companies operating in China or those with significant Chinese investments.
  • Supply Chain Disruptions: China's dominance in the manufacturing of certain data center components can create supply chain vulnerabilities. Geopolitical tensions could disrupt these supply chains, leading to delays and increased costs.
  • Data Sovereignty Concerns: Concerns around data sovereignty and national security are prompting governments globally to favor local data center solutions, potentially reducing the attractiveness of certain international players.
